Intent to package: tkSETI



Hi,

I intend to package tkSETI, a GUI frontend to the SETI@Home client for
Unix.  TkSETI is GPLed. The homepage for tkSETI is
http://www.cuug.ab.ca/~macdonal/tkseti/tkseti.html 
This program requires the user to download the SETI@Home unix client
from the official SETI@Home website: http://setiathome.ssl.berkeley.edu/
SETI@Home is a unique scientific experiment that harnesses the power of
thousands of internet-connected computers in the Search for
Extra-Terrestrial Intelligence (SETI). 

A question for developers: tkSETI the frontend is GPL. But the
setiathome client is only available as a binary (for both scientific
and security considerations. Scientific, because the SETI folks don't
want you to change the data analysis style. Security because hackers
could compromise their database server). Is tkseti then non-free?
